Output c2630d85661c32aa55e3101c998977e3bc39966b09542074140e6b0af6455a28:1

value
80743965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0cf9e7ec454f70ae8a2611bc6790f9b75c388c OP_EQUAL
address
MLrFjGj6QTyijkHxB2P3SMesw2hZHj6ubh
transaction
c2630d85661c32aa55e3101c998977e3bc39966b09542074140e6b0af6455a28
spent
true